A New Design of Experimental Schemes of Complex Matrix LDA

Two-Dimension Linear Discriminant Analysis (2DLDA) and complex-matrix LDA are two noticeable improvements to conventional LDA. They can achieve a good performance respectively. However, the complex-matrix LDA is very suitable for bimodal biometrics. In this paper, we indicate the two available implementation procedures of complex-matrix, i.e. the original implementation procedure and one alternative implementation procedure proposed in this work. The following new implementation scheme for complex-matrix LDA would be designed: Firstly, the two available implementation procedures of complex-matrix LDA will be carried out and then their results to perform face recognition using the matching score fusion algorithm integrated. A highter classification accuracy indecates the proposed implementation scheme more useful than both of the two available implementation procedures of complex-matrix LDA.
